Output 04d25607e1306e1669498f129228b184b8ea6993efc5b09832abf16259a5329e:0

value
787896
script pubkey
OP_HASH160 OP_PUSHBYTES_20 df3a450a70a152914c7b1a6e38698848a9e431c4 OP_EQUAL
address
3N3LQyGkETRhUZP5UXrsWJemEeYZVFEsLV
transaction
04d25607e1306e1669498f129228b184b8ea6993efc5b09832abf16259a5329e
spent
true